webroot.com/safe
Computer Manufacture
webroot.com/safe 8415 Explorer Dr #150, Colorado Springs, CO 80920, USA, Colorado, Colorado, united state, 10005 (Show me directions) Show Map
Computer Manufacture
webroot.com/safe 8415 Explorer Dr #150, Colorado Springs, CO 80920, USA, Colorado, Colorado, united state, 10005 (Show me directions) Show Map